What’s the Price of the 2019 BMW M6 Gran Coupe? Available in just one trim, the BMW M6 Gran Coupe has an MSRP of $119,900, with the price excluding tax, registration, and a $995 destination and handling charge. While a dual-clutch automatic transmission is standard, a six-speed manual is a no-cost option. Is the 650i Gran Coupe expensive to maintain?

The estimated cost to maintain and repair a BMW 650i Gran Coupe ranges from $105 to $5541, with an average of $496.
